To make it possible to construct a communication area without being limited to an area where communication with a fixed base station is possible.SOLUTION: An installation location determination method is for determining a location where a flying object charging device 1 is installed that has charging means for charging a battery of a flying object 2 that relays communication and is executed by a computer. The installation location determination method includes an area information acquisition step of acquiring area information that indicates the range of a communication area which is constructed by the flying object 2 and where a wireless communication service can be used, and a determination step of determining the installation location of the flying object charging device 1 based on the area information.SELECTED DRAWING: Figure 3
